/** * Similar to add(), but if the sender already exists, its seqnos will be modified (no new entry) as follows: * <ol> * <li>this.low_seqno=min(this.low_seqno, low_seqno) * <li>this.highest_delivered_seqno=max(this.highest_delivered_seqno, highest_delivered_seqno) * <li>this.highest_received_seqno=max(this.highest_received_seqno, highest_received_seqno) * </ol> * If the sender doesn not exist, a new entry will be added (provided there is enough space) */ public void merge(Address sender, long low_seqno, long highest_delivered_seqno, long highest_received_seqno) { if(sender == null) { if(log.isErrorEnabled()) log.error("sender == null"); return; } checkSealed(); Entry entry=senders.get(sender); if(entry == null) { add(sender, low_seqno, highest_delivered_seqno, highest_received_seqno); } else { Entry new_entry=new Entry(Math.min(entry.getLow(), low_seqno), Math.max(entry.getHighestDeliveredSeqno(), highest_delivered_seqno), Math.max(entry.getHighestReceivedSeqno(), highest_received_seqno)); senders.put(sender, new_entry); } }
/** * Adds a digest to this digest. This digest must have enough space to add the other digest; otherwise an error * message will be written. For each sender in the other digest, the merge() method will be called. */ public void merge(Digest digest) { if(digest == null) { if(log.isErrorEnabled()) log.error("digest to be merged with is null"); return; } checkSealed(); Map.Entry<Address,Entry> entry; Address sender; Entry val; for(Iterator<Map.Entry<Address,Entry>> it=digest.senders.entrySet().iterator(); it.hasNext();) { entry=it.next(); sender=entry.getKey(); val=entry.getValue(); if(val != null) { merge(sender, val.getLow(), val.getHighestDeliveredSeqno(), val.getHighestReceivedSeqno()); } } }
